Considering this, what is an example of dry heat sterilization?
Several types include hot air oven, incineration, and flaming. Objects that cannot get wet, glassware, oils, powder, metal instruments, and paper wrapped items use dry heat for sterilization. Validation is a series of tests to make sure that the dry heat instruments are working as intended.

Furthermore, how does dry heat kill bacteria?
Dry heat helps kill the organisms using the destructive oxidation method. This helps destroy large contaminating bio-molecules such as proteins. The essential cell constituents are destroyed and the organism dies. The temperature is maintained for almost an hour to kill the most difficult of the resistant spores.

What is the principle of autoclaving?
Autoclaves Working Principle: Autoclaves use pressurized steam as their sterilization agent.
